SQL进阶篇1——通用语法

 一、SQL语句规范

  • SQL语句可以单行和多行书写,以分号结尾
  • SQL语句可以使用空格/缩进增强语言的可读性
  • Mysql数据库的SQL语句不区分大小写,关键字建议使用大写
  • 单行注释:--注释内容 或者 #注释内容 (MySQL特有)
  • 多行注释:/* 注释内容 */ 快捷键(开启注释 ctrl + K再加上C

二、SQL分类

 一般在安装mysql时候,mysql服务器是默认打开的,所以我们通常输入:

mysql -u root -p
Enter password: ****** //输入密码

得到:

  •  show databases  (查看数据库)
  • creat database (创建数据库)
  • use mysql (选择当前数据库)
  • select database(查询当前数据库)
  • show tables (查询当数据库所有表名)
  • desc 表名(查询表名)

  • drop database (删除数据库)
  • alter table 表名 ADD/MODIFY/CHANGE/DROP
  • drop table 表名;
  • 创建一个名为dog表
create table dog ( 
字段1 字段1类型 (comment 字段注释),
字段2 字段2类型  (comment 字段注释2),
) comment 表注释
  • desc 表名 (查看当前表)
  • 为dog表增加一个新的字段为nickname ,类型nickename,类型为varchar(20);
alter table dog nickname varchar(20);
  • 修改字段名和字段类型
Alter table dog change nickname username varchar(30);

 修改表名

alter table dog rename to XXX
  • 1
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 1
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论 1
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值